Three twin-screw steel patrol boats, Atalanta, Ariadne, and Cyane, building at Lake Union Dry Dock and Machine Works, Seattle; length oa 165 ft; beam molded at main deck 25 ft 3 in.; propelled by two Winton 6-cyl valve-in-head, solid-injection, 4-cycle, directly reversible Diesel engines, each developing 670 shp at 450 rpm.
